ehehe
All checks were successful
Test compiling project / test (push) Successful in 1m47s

This commit is contained in:
2024-12-20 23:00:46 +01:00
parent 7fe0eda3ba
commit 1f048db3ce
3 changed files with 5 additions and 2 deletions

View File

@@ -1,4 +1,5 @@
#include "json_builder.h"
#include <ArduinoLog.h>
extern WaterData water_data;
extern DeviceTelemetry telemetry;
@@ -29,7 +30,7 @@ StaticJsonDocument<128> build_telemetry_json(DeviceTelemetry data) {
return doc;
}
StaticJsonDocument<128> build_network_json(NetworkData wired, NetworkData wireless) {
StaticJsonDocument<256> build_network_json(NetworkData wired, NetworkData wireless) {
StaticJsonDocument<256> doc;
doc["wifi"]["ip"] = wireless.ip_address;
doc["wifi"]["rssi"] = wireless.rssi;

View File

@@ -4,4 +4,4 @@
StaticJsonDocument<128> build_shunt_data_json(SensorData data);
StaticJsonDocument<128> build_water_data_json(WaterData data);
StaticJsonDocument<128> build_telemetry_json(DeviceTelemetry data);
StaticJsonDocument<128> build_network_json(NetworkData wired, NetworkData wireless);
StaticJsonDocument<256> build_network_json(NetworkData wired, NetworkData wireless);

View File

@@ -65,6 +65,7 @@ void wifi_task(void* parameter)
wifi_data.ip_address = WiFi.localIP().toString();
Log.verbose("RSSI: %F, IP Address, %p, SSID: %s", float(WiFi.RSSI()), WiFi.localIP(), prefs.getString(ssid_key, "NOSSID"));
Serial.println(WiFi.channel());
delay(5000);
} else {
Log.verbose("Connecting to %s using password %s", prefs.getString(ssid_key, ""), prefs.getString(wifi_password_key, ""));
@@ -86,6 +87,7 @@ void ethernet_task(void* parameter)
ethernet_data.link = ETH.linkUp();
ethernet_data.rssi = ETH.linkSpeed();
ethernet_data.ip_address = ETH.localIP().toString();
Log.verbose("Ethernet RSSI: %F, IP Address, %s, LINK: %s", float(ethernet_data.rssi), ethernet_data.ip_address, String(ethernet_data.link));
delay(60 * 1000);
}
}